Transaction 370152ed44bc94bfb780a95d2dde71b8492e0d820d8e6e6ec5856314f75728a9
1 Input
1 Output
-
370152ed44bc94bfb780a95d2dde71b8492e0d820d8e6e6ec5856314f75728a9:0
- value
- 513426
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ba8556d8477cfeb9fbe2a180fe55c5704a940394 OP_EQUAL
- address
- 3JhFLoAuFZQaGbXM7AjEe5fbgSHVHEaPVt